    Hey folks,
    So recently got a new laptop, Sony Vaio - grand job. Windows 8 - looks flashy.

    Anyway one week later out of the blue I suddenly get BSOD BAD_POOL_HEADER.

    Downloaded a program called BlueScreenViewer to see the reason and this is what I got:

    The error was caused by CLVirtualDrive.sys -> now I have Daemon Tools running on my system and have loaded images etc.

    Anyone have similar problems? I'm guessing Daemon Tools is the issue here?

    That file is related to some piece of CyberLink software. Right click on the far bottom left side of the screen in Windows 8, click on control panel, click programs and features, right click on anything that says CyberLink and click uninstall. Problem most likely solved :)


  • Registered Users, Registered Users 2 Posts: 2,690 ✭✭✭ElChe32


    Yep thanks, seems to have done the job, did a disk check too. All seems 100% again.
